    Regarding the first puzzle although I don't have a solution, below is what I have so far. Let me know if anything else.

    - The intro discussion mentions the character has been away 8 years (this is mentioned 4 times so must be important) and that he left when he was 13.
    - Engineer Felix states the lock combo is a graduation date.
    - The yearbook title reads "Yearbook 2, March Pierre 34, Saint Troite Elementary School"
    - I googled March Pierre. The best indication I got was that perhaps March Pierre is a character name. Originally I though March was a month (03).
    - I can not find a year the game occurs (originally thinking the yearbook was from 1934).
    - Combinations 1934-1950 do not seem to work work, nor doe 1834-1850. 0234 also does not work.
    - Given variants of the date format I assume the lock answer will be a full year date (i.e. 2011) excluding date/month.

    Found the solution to the first yearbook lock combo puzzle!

    If you want a hint then
    use a date format with a 2 digit year followed by month and day.

    If you just want to know the answer it's
    3432
    .

    It's an awkward puzzle
    because not every culture puts the year first in dates or keeps the same numerical arrangement
    so I'd recommend revising it in the final game.
    I guess the "yearbook 2, march" means march 2nd.
